Understanding the Shift from In-Person to Online

Impact of the Pandemic

The global pandemic brought dramatic changes to daily life, including the tax preparation process. Prior to 2020, many tax professionals like myself conducted business mainly in person. However, the necessity of keeping people safe and reducing in-person interactions due to the virus forced a shift towards online and secure drop-off methods. This change has provided both convenience and security for taxpayers.

In-Person Tax Filing: A Personal Touch

Reasons to Choose In-Person Filing

Direct Personal Interaction: In-person tax preparation allows taxpayers to meet with their preparers face to face, ensuring a detailed understanding of their tax situation.

No-Hassle Document Submission: In-person tax preparation eliminates the need for digital document submissions and complex portal logins.

Instant Clarification: Taxpayers can immediately receive answers to any questions and concerns, providing peace of mind.

Steps to Prepare for In-Person Tax Filing

Research and Choose a Trusted Professional: Look for reputable tax preparers with good reviews and a track record of accuracy.

Collect All Necessary Documents: Before scheduling an appointment, gather all required documents including W-2s, 1099s, and any other relevant paperwork.

Schedule an Appointment: Find a tax preparer who offers flexible appointment times to accommodate your schedule.
